Things to Do around Hungry Horse

Hungry Horse is a region in Montana, characterized by its spectacular mountain scenery, pristine waters, and diverse terrain, making it a prime destination for outdoor activities. The area is centered around the vast Hungry Horse Reservoir, which spans 34 miles and is surrounded by majestic mountain peaks. Nestled within the expansive Flathead National Forest, the landscape features rugged wilderness, abundant lakes, and dense evergreen forests, providing a rich natural backdrop for exploration.

Frequently asked questions

What outdoor activities are available in Hungry Horse?

The Hungry Horse region offers extensive opportunities for outdoor activities, primarily focusing on hiking. The area features diverse trails within the Flathead National Forest, catering to various skill levels. During winter, snowshoeing is also a popular activity on snow-covered trails.

What are the best hiking trails in Hungry Horse?

The region offers a variety of hiking trails. Notable options include the 8-mile (12.9 km) Great Northern Trail, the Columbia Mountain Trail with significant elevation gain, and the moderate 5.8-mile (9.3 km) Baptiste Lookout trail. The Gateway to Glacier Trail provides a flat, paved option suitable for many users.

Are there easy or family-friendly hiking trails in Hungry Horse?

Yes, the Hungry Horse region includes trails suitable for families and beginners. The Gateway to Glacier Trail is a flat, paved option. Many trails within the Flathead National Forest offer varying levels of difficulty, including easier strolls.

What natural features and landmarks can be seen in Hungry Horse?

Key natural features include the Hungry Horse Reservoir, which spans 34 miles (54.7 km) and is surrounded by mountain peaks. The Hungry Horse Dam, Montana's highest at 564 feet (172 meters), is a significant landmark. The region is also part of the Flathead National Forest, encompassing the Jewel Basin Hiking Area and the Great Bear Wilderness.

What is the best time of year for hiking in Hungry Horse?

Hiking is popular during the warmer months. The fall season is particularly scenic when larch needles turn yellow around the reservoir. Snowshoeing is possible on trails during the winter months.

Are dogs allowed on hiking trails in Hungry Horse?

Many trails within the Flathead National Forest, which encompasses the Hungry Horse region, are generally dog-friendly. However, specific regulations may apply to certain areas or trails, so checking local signage or forest service guidelines is advisable.

What wildlife can be observed in Hungry Horse?

The diverse ecosystems support various wildlife, including big-game species such as bear, elk, moose, bighorn sheep, and deer. Birdwatchers can spot songbirds, hawks, eagles, and owls. Bears are commonly encountered on upper parts of trails during huckleberry season.

What is the contact information for the Hungry Horse-Glacier View Ranger Station?

The phone number for the Hungry Horse-Glacier View Ranger Station is (406) 387-3800. This station can provide information on local trails and conditions within the Flathead National Forest.

Are there challenging hiking trails in Hungry Horse?

Yes, the region offers challenging options such as the Columbia Mountain Trail, which features a significant elevation gain of 1,522 meters (4,993 feet). This trail provides clear views of the Flathead Valley.

What is the Hungry Horse Reservoir?

The Hungry Horse Reservoir is a large body of water in the region, spanning 34 miles (54.7 km) and surrounded by over 25 mountain peaks. It is fed by the South Fork of the Flathead River and features approximately 170 miles (273.6 km) of shoreline.

What is the Flathead National Forest?

The Flathead National Forest is an expansive area covering 2.4 million acres (971,245 hectares) that includes rugged wilderness, numerous lakes, and wild rivers. The Hungry Horse region is nestled within this forest, offering a vast backdrop for outdoor recreation.
